TEACHING NATURE HOW TO JIVE

A Poem by R J Askew
"

They say we are out of step with nature... But hey, we can fix everything, right? Yo! Can do! Yes sir!

"

Express yourself

You can!

Watch my feet

Get this right and...

Latest Sony PS yours

Choice of games

Grand Theft Auto, yours

Isn't that worth dancing for?

So says cool young man to old nature's face

 

Remove yourself to country mind away

Relaxation rose knows around oak door

A month of nothing loving emptiness

No people, only poems in your head

Sun swimming in your clear chalk stream of life

You are your heron, watching patiently

As to the mill you take your sack of words

To mill, to mill into a fruity bread

Remove yourself to country mind away

Relaxation rose knows around oak door

 

This will not do!

This is not me

For I am Man

And lust to win

Must win win, win win, win win

 

Dance!

Dance

Dance, step, one step, two step, cha-cha, cha

Be natural, like me

 

O Man! I cannot get in step with you

Cannot, cannot, you feet  -- they move so fast

 

Dance!

DANCE!

One step, two step

Watch me

Watch my feet

Money, sex, power, more

Money, sex, power, more

 

O Man! My feet are sore

My feet are sore, are sore

I know a field where you can hay with dreams

Please...

My feet! they are Al Gore

 

Nature, Nature

Don't you want to dance like me?

Like me

Love me!

O yes! love me, love me, love me more and more

Me!

Love Me!

Nay, why are you looking at me like that?
